mikejasond wrote:
Oh and it bothers me that Even Flow is some weird remix. Apparently according to wikipedia it's the single version but regardless it's not the version everybody knows and it's kind of lame that they put one of their top 3 hits as an alternate version.


The single version is equally as important to people my age because it was the version that aired on MTV over and over and over again. It was also the version on the CD single which a lot of people bought to get "Dirty Frank". Calling it an "alternate version", is quite frankly incorrect. It's the "hit single version" and the version that the band prefers! And to people who didn't buy "Ten", but bought singles and watched MTV, it was the "correct" version.
